Diesel on Cassier Highway

I will need diesel at least once on the Cassier before hitting the Alcan. GasBuddy's not showing much but don't know how good GB is in Canada.

Are there stations along the highwy which carry diesel?

  • They last few trips we have made on the Cassiar Hwy have been in diesel powered vehicles. There are 4 or 5 stations that carry diesel. Northbound I usually fill up at the intersection at Kitwanga. Also a nice restaurant attached to the station. If you are going to take the side road into Stewart, BC, they also have diesel. Dease Lake has been a stop for us several times in the past. Several nice campgrounds in the area, plus the gas station - grocery store has an excellent deli. Bell II, roadhouse has diesel, as does Iskut and then at the far end where the Cassiar joins the Alaska Hwy about 13 miles north of Watson Lake.
